The remains of an American missile revealed the site of a massacre that turned a wedding party in the Iranian city of Sirik into a tragedy in which men, including children, were killed.

In this context, NBC News reported, citing a US official, that Central Command (Centcom) is investigating the circumstances of the strike.

For his part, Iranian Parliament Speaker Mohammad Bagher Qalibaf denounced the massacre, describing Washington as "the Great Satan."

Based on a review of photos and videos, weapons experts concluded that the explosion that destroyed the wedding party, killed four people and injured 68 others, was caused by a direct hit with American munitions. Experts ruled out that the damage was caused by a projectile ricocheting from a nearby target or an errant Iranian air defense missile.

Trevor Ball, a weapons technical analyst, confirmed that the damage was consistent with a munition that exploded when it touched the ceiling or directly above it, suggesting that it was from an American joint confrontation weapon.

In turn, retired officer Gareth Collett explained that the evidence indicates an American missile weighing 500 pounds that was dropped by air, pointing out that errors sometimes occur even with advanced guidance systems. As for Sebastian Schutte of the Peace Research Institute in Oslo, he ruled out that the hole in the ceiling was the result of a ricochet, noting that the angle of impact was not consistent with an air defense missile.

The tragedy occurred in the small town of Kohstuk, where residents had gathered for a wedding. The American raid initially targeted a civilian communications tower 135 meters away from the ceremony site. Two American officials explained that the army launched the raids, targeting communications and radar towers to prevent Iran from threatening navigation in the Strait of Hormuz.

This strike claimed the lives of four people, including a four-year-old child, while 68 others were injured, according to human rights documentation. This incident comes more than six months after a similar raid that destroyed a primary school in Minab and claimed the lives of 175 girls and teachers, an incident about which the Pentagon did not publish the results of its internal investigation as promised at the time.

Iranian media published pictures of fragments of American weapons scattered among the rubble, amid a state of sadness and shock throughout the town of Sirik. Local authorities reportedly put pressure on witnesses to prevent them from speaking to foreign media, while residents spread the bodies of the victims in a solemn funeral procession.
